Key concepts and overview
Crypto casinos are online gambling platforms that accept cryptocurrencies as a form of payment. These casinos operate similarly to traditional online casinos but leverage blockchain technology to enhance security and transparency. Players can deposit, wager, and withdraw using various c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in. The core idea behind crypto casinos is to provide a decentralized and secure gambling experience, free from the restrictions often associated with conventional banking systems.
Moreover, the anonymity offered by cryptocurrencies appeals to many players, allowing them to engage in gambling activities without revealing their personal information. Main features and details
Crypto casinos come with several distinct features that set them apart from traditional online gambling sites. One of the primary components is the use of blockchain technology, which ensures that all transactions are recorded on a public ledger, providing transparency and security. This technology also facilitates faster transactions, as players can deposit and withdraw funds almost instantly, unlike traditional banking methods that may take several days.
- Variety of Games: Crypto casinos typically offer a wide range of games, including slots, table games, and live dealer options. The integration of cryptocurrencies allows for innovative game designs and unique betting options.
- Bonuses and Promotions: Many crypto casinos provide attractive bonuses for new players, including deposit matches and free spins. These promotions are often more generous than those found in traditional casinos.
- Provably Fair Gaming: This feature allows players to verify the fairness of each game outcome, ensuring that the results are not manipulated. This transparency is a significant selling point for crypto casinos.

Advantages and disadvantages
While crypto casinos offer numerous benefits, they also come with certain drawbacks that industry analysts must consider. On the positive side, the advantages include:
- Enhanced Security: The use of blockchain technology provides a high level of security for transactions, reducing the risk of fraud.
- Anonymity: Players can enjoy a level of privacy that is often not available with traditional casinos.
- Faster Transactions: Deposits and withdrawals are processed quickly, allowing players to access their funds without delay.
However, there are also disadvantages to consider:
- Regulatory Challenges: The legal status of cryptocurrencies varies by jurisdiction, which can create uncertainty for players and operators.
- Volatility: The value of cryptocurrencies can fluctuate significantly, impacting players’ bankrolls.
- Limited Acceptance: Not all casinos accept cryptocurrencies, which may limit options for players who prefer this payment method.
